Council rejects variance request to allow home addition at 259 North Greenwood

Village of Palatine Council · August 2, 2026

Council and committee votes denied a special-use/variation to place a building addition 5 feet from the side property line and a related setback variation at 259 North Greenwood Avenue. The petitioner said winter damage to her car motivated the request.

A petition to allow a building addition closer to the side property line at 259 North Greenwood Avenue failed in committee and again when considered by the full council.

Planning staff described the request as an addition to the principal structure with implications for setbacks and lot conformity; the petitioner, Maria Picarska, said the structure was needed to protect her car from winter damage: "I just need something for my car, because last month... it damaged my car." Neighbors and several council members raised concerns about visual character, nonconforming adjacent properties, and the narrowness of the lot. The committee voted against the item and pulled it from the consent agenda for standing-committee review; when the matter returned to council the motion failed on roll call.

Council members emphasized the importance of consistency with existing code and the concerns of immediate neighbors when considering setback exceptions. The item will be tracked for any future resubmission or revised proposal.
